News

Students will problem solve, explore real-world software development challenges, and create practical and contemporary applications. This course assumes previous programming experience. Prerequisites ...
The Federal Government recently announced the launch of a revamped national curriculum for secondary schools; junior and ...
If you have an old Raspberry Pi sitting around, here are some fun ways to make use of it, from building a smart home hub to a ...
With vibe-coding, anyone can become a coder. But can they grow into a software engineer?
Beyond big projects, doing smaller, focused exercises is super helpful. GeeksforGeeks has tons of these, covering everything ...
As a child, inspired by an episode of "Sid the Science Kid," Kaylie Murangwa once tried to pry open her family's television, ...
Overview: Claude 4 generates accurate, scalable code across multiple languages, turning vague prompts into functional solutions.It detects errors, optimizes per ...
Apurva Pathak is a prominent machine learning expert and software engineer currently based in Newark, California. With a ...
Fig. 1: Modeling qubits in a realistic way involves large-scale atomistic models with possibly amorphous materials, disorder, ...
At the frontiers of knowledge, researchers are discovering that A.I. doesn’t just take prompts—it gives them, too, sparking ...